About Me

Guitarist, Singer, and Songwriter Alastair Greene has been a mainstay of the Southern California music scene for nearly 2 decades. He has played with a multitude of artists, the best known being Alan Parsons, Aynsley Dunbar (John Mayall, Journey, Frank Zappa), and Mitch Kashmar (WAR). Alastair has appeared with a host of musicians from bands such as Los Lobos, The Steve Miller Band, Crosby Stills & Nash, The Electric Flag, and The Mars Volta in bars, clubs, and on concert stages throughout California.

Best known for his blues-based, soulful, and melodic guitar playing (as well as one of a rare-breed to play slide guitar), Alastair can be heard on CDs by Alan Parsons (2006 Grammy Nominated ‘A Valid Path’); Aynsley Dunbar’s Retaliation (new CD due out early 2008 on SPV in Europe); Blues singer, harmonica legend, and member of WAR, Mitch Kashmar (2005 ‘Wake Up and Worry’ on Delta Groove Records), as well as French Blues Guitarist Franck Golwasser’s 2007 release ‘Bluju.’ Alastair has put out 4 of his own CDs (Alastair’s cover band Trio Grande released a new CD ‘Live At SOhO’ in July 2007), which are available from his website www.agsongs.com (as well as here on myspace), and has also appeared on countless independent CD releases ranging from Folk to Blues to Southern Rock.

Over the last 10 years, Alastair has appeared at The Santa Barbara Bowl, The House Of Blues in Hollywood, The Roxy, The Whiskey, The Mint, and B.B. King’s at Universal City Walk. In 2004, Alastair was invited to Belgium for the Spring Blues Festival with Mitch Kashmar and Franck Goldwasser. Topping off 2006 was a guest appearance with the Alan Parsons Live Project at a fundraiser at the Arlington Theatre in Santa Barbara. Alastair was again invited onstage with Alan Parsons at Humphrey’s in San Diego in June of 2007. Whether with his own band or as part of others, Alastair has opened shows and shared the stage with The Fabulous Thunderbirds, Robin Trower, John Mayall & The Bluesbreakers, Lonnie Brooks, Lucky Petersen, and many more.
